I will be buying the Asus P5K-E motherboard and E6750 and need 2gb memory for it. The system will run at stock speed for now. I will buy 800mhz chips. My questions are:

Which memory company?
What timings will run best at stock speeds?
What timings will run best at 400mhz FSB?
What memory will work with the P5K-E board?
What memory will run at 1.8 volts and offer the best timings?
Are timings of 4-4-4-12 the best speeds to look for?
I have OCZ PC2 6400 (ocz2p800r22gk) timings are 4-4-4-15 1.9 to 2.1 volts, If I run this memory at 667mhz for a 1:1 ratio, will I be able to drop the voltage to motherboard default of 1.8 volts?

1. Crucial Ballistix.
2. Depends on the board, you'll have to try different timings yourself and benchmark your system with Sisoft Sandra.
3. See above.
4. Pretty much anything.
5. Ballistix PC8500.
6. See answer number 2. PC6400 that has cas3 timings will be better quality than PC6400 cas4 but more expensive, it's often cheaper to buy PC8500 and underclock it.
7. Yes, you should be able to.
